Ricciardo advises Red Bull: "Despite bad relationship, they won races with Renault

Due to Honda's imminent departure in Formula 1, Red Bull Racing and AlphaTauri have to look for a new engine supplier for 2022. Mercedes have already indicated that they are not open to a possible deal, so Red Bull will have to choose between Renault and Ferrari. They have already had a deal with the French, but it ended disappointingly. Due to many breakdowns in 2018, in which Max Verstappen was often heard speaking negatively about the onboard radio, Red Bull made the choice to go to Honda. Now they have to look for a new engine again and Renault would be open to that. Daniel Ricciardo does expect that the cooperation between the two parties can be rebuilt.
